Although the substrates of atrial fibrillation, its initiation and maintenance, remain to be fully elucidated, catheter ablation in the left atrium has become a therapeutic option for patients with this arrhythmia. With ablation techniques, various isolation lines and focal targets are deployed; the majority of these are anatomic approaches. It has been over a decade since we published our first article on the anatomy of the left atrium relevant to interventional electrophysiologists. 1 Our aim then, as now, was to increase awareness of anatomic structures inside the left atrium. In this review of anatomy, we revisit the left atrium, inside as well as outside, for a better understanding of the atrial component parts and the spatial relationships of specific structures.
